Has anyone had a uterine ablation?

I have had years of heavy periods. I have had to live my life around my periods and ended up so anaemic I needed iron infusions.
Yesterday, I had a uterine ablation in a hysteroscopy clinic, under a local.
The procedure wasn’t too bad and pain was not that bad either.
The gynaecologist said it went well and I asked him if I’d experience much pain after the anaesthesia had worn off, he said no.
However, when I walked back to the car, I started to feel very crampy in that area. By the time I got home it was really quite painful, a constant tooth ache type pain which radiated to my back and hips/legs (I have a weird, tilted uterus which leans back and to the left so not sure if this contributed to the back/hip pain?).
The pain continued all evening (had the procedure at 4.30pm), I ended up going to bed at 7pm and tossed and turned with the discomfort. Took 2 paracetamol which didn’t touch it then a nurofen which seemed to help a little.
Luckily I did eventually sleep and had a good night.
I’ve woken up this morning and (fingers crossed) the pain seems to have subsided, just passing some blood, like a light period.
Really hoping the op has been successful and the pain doesn’t come back.
Has anyone had this done? How was your recovery?
